Why Glycolic Acid Body Moisturiser is Necessary
I’ve found that a glycolic acid body moisturiser does more than just hydrate my skin — it helps keep it smoother, brighter, and healthier-looking. Because glycolic acid gently exfoliates, it removes dead skin cells that can make my skin feel rough, dull, or uneven. My skin absorbs moisture better after that, so the moisturiser feels more effective than a regular lotion.
I also like that it helps with common body concerns like dry patches, bumpy texture, and ingrown hairs. When I use it regularly, my skin feels softer and looks more even over time. For me, it’s a simple way to combine exfoliation and hydration in one step, which saves time and gives my skin a more polished finish.
Another reason I consider it necessary is that it supports long-term skin care. My body skin often gets neglected compared to my face, but it still needs care to stay smooth and comfortable. A glycolic acid body moisturiser helps me maintain that balance by treating and nourishing my skin at the same time.
My Buying Guides on Glycolic Acid Body Moisturiser
What I Look for First
When I choose a glycolic acid body moisturiser, I first check the glycolic acid percentage. I usually prefer a formula that is effective but not too harsh on the skin. I also look at whether the product is meant for daily use or occasional exfoliation, because that helps me avoid overdoing it.
My Skin Type Matters
I always match the moisturiser to my skin type. If my skin feels sensitive, I look for a gentler formula with soothing ingredients like aloe vera, shea butter, or ceramides. If my skin is rough, bumpy, or dull, I prefer a stronger exfoliating body moisturiser that can help smooth texture over time.
Ingredients I Prefer
I pay close attention to the ingredient list. Besides glycolic acid, I like seeing hydrating ingredients such as h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and niacinamide. These help me get the benefits of exfoliation without leaving my skin dry or irritated.
Texture and Absorption
For me, texture is important because I want a body moisturiser that spreads easily and absorbs well. I usually avoid products that feel too sticky or greasy, especially if I plan to use them during the day. A lightweight but nourishing formula works best for my routine.
How I Check for Sensitivity
I always do a patch test before using a new glycolic acid body moisturiser all over my body. This helps me see how my skin reacts and reduces the chance of irritation. If I notice redness, stinging, or dryness, I usually stop using it and switch to a milder option.
When I Use It
I think about when I’ll apply the product. Some glycolic acid body moisturisers work best at night because glycolic acid can make skin more sensitive to sunlight. If I use one during the day, I make sure to apply sunscreen on exposed areas.
Packaging and Ease of Use
I like packaging that is practical and hygienic. A pump bottle or tube is usually easier for me to use than a jar, especially when I want to apply the product quickly after a shower. Good packaging also helps keep the formula fresh.
Value for Money
I compare the price with the size of the bottle and the quality of ingredients. A higher price does not always mean better results, so I look for a product that gives me good hydration, gentle exfoliation, and lasting value.
